Transaction 58a06b3da5f06dbc57fc6ba4d26a2c6b819b8c95f3fc0c96dfd6f60cdafdf579

block
f1c9f7adec33e8ba886f9ea16b27570fac514eaf956c3e3985462ea4523d44b7

1 Input

23 Outputs